Question: 1 of 37: Alice earned $622.50 in interest on her savings in the bank. Before interest, the account had $12,450. What i

s the approximate percent she earned in interest?
3%
5%
7%
10%
Business
1 answer:
SpyIntel [72]3 years ago
8 0
<span>Alice had original amount = $12,450. She earned an interest of $622.50 on the original amount. To find the percent, say, $622.50 = x% of $12,450, we get x% = 0.05 or x = 5%. Thus, Alice earned approximately 5% of the interest.</span>

Classify the following topics as relating to microeconomics or macroeconomics. Topic: Microeconomics or Macroeconomics
goldenfox [79]

Answer: MICROECONOMICS

1.The effect of a change in price of one good on a related good.

MACROECONOMICS

2. The relationship between the inflation rate and the unemployment rate.

3.The effect of government subsidies on the agricultural industry.

Explanation: Microeconomics is a term of the to describe the impact of certain conditions on a single product or service,it doesn't consist of the whole economy or country.

Macroeconomics is a term used to describe the impact of certain conditions on the whole economy or country. Inflation rate, unemployment rate, effects of subsidy in Agriculture etc are all Macroeconomics statistics give better understanding of the economic performance.

Complete question :

A company is considering constructing a plant to manufacture a proposed new product. The land costs $350,000, the building costs $600,000, the equipment costs $250,000, and $150,000 additional working capital is required. It is expected that the product will result in sales of $900,000 per year for 10 years, at which time the land can be sold for $450,000, the building for $400,000, and the equipment for $50,000. All of the working capital would be recovered at the EOY 10. The annual expenses for labor, materials, and all other items are estimated to total $500,000. If the company requires a MARR of 15% per year on projects of comparable risk, determine if it should invest in the new product line. Use the AW method.

Answer: $182,800

Explanation:

Given the following :

land costs = $350,000

building costs = $600,000

equipment costs = $250,000

additional working capital = $150,000

Expected sales per year for 10 years = $900,000

Salvage value After (10years):

Cost of land = $450,000

Building = $400,000

Equipment = $50,000

All working capital will be recovered at end of year, Hence, working capital will be $150,000

Annual expenses = $500,000

MARR = 15% per annum

Total amount invested = $(350,000 + 600,000 + 250,000 + 150,000) = $1,350,000

Expected sales per Annum = annual revenue = $900,000

Expenditure per year = $500,000

Net income = Revenue - Expenditure

Net income = $900,000 - $500,000 = $400,000

Worth or valuation of investment after 10 years :

($450,000 + $50,000 + $400,000 + $150,000)

= $1,050,000

Hence,

Capital recovery factor : (A/P, 15%, 10) = 0.199

Sinking fund table : (A/F, 15%, 10) =0.049

NET ANNUAL WORTH :

-Initial investment(A/P, 15%, 10) + annual net income + salvage value(A/F, 15%,10)

= - 1,350,000(0.199) + 400,000 + 1,050,000(0.049)

= $182,800

The investment is economically justified as the net annual worth yields a positive value.
